Skip to content

Commit f191da4

Browse files
committed
Add remaining libm crates to the workspace
These are still not yet covered in CI since we always name explicit packages there, but all crates are now part of the workspace.
1 parent a5ba95e commit f191da4

File tree

2 files changed

+6
-8
lines changed

2 files changed

+6
-8
lines changed

Cargo.toml

Lines changed: 4 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-4,20 +4,18 @@ members = [
44
"builtins-test",
55
"compiler-builtins",
66
"crates/libm-macros",
7+
"crates/musl-math-sys",
8+
"crates/util",
79
"libm",
8-
# FIXME(libm): disabled until tests work in CI
9-
# "libm-test",
10-
# "crates/musl-math-sys",
11-
# "crates/util",
10+
"libm-test",
1211
]
1312

1413
default-members = [
1514
"builtins-test",
1615
"compiler-builtins",
1716
"crates/libm-macros",
18-
# FIXME(libm): disabled until tests work in CI
19-
# "crates/libm-test"
2017
"libm",
18+
"libm-test",
2119
]
2220

2321
exclude = [

libm-test/tests/check_coverage.rs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 macro_rules! callback {
1919

2020
#[test]
2121
fn test_for_each_function_all_included() {
22-
let all_functions: HashSet<_> = include_str!("../../../etc/function-list.txt")
22+
let all_functions: HashSet<_> = include_str!("../../etc/function-list.txt")
2323
.lines()
2424
.filter(|line| !line.starts_with("#"))
2525
.collect();
@@ -52,7 +52,7 @@ fn ensure_list_updated() {
5252
}
5353

5454
let res = Command::new("python3")
55-
.arg(Path::new(env!("CARGO_MANIFEST_DIR")).join("../../etc/update-api-list.py"))
55+
.arg(Path::new(env!("CARGO_MANIFEST_DIR")).join("../etc/update-api-list.py"))
5656
.arg("--check")
5757
.status()
5858
.unwrap();

0 commit comments

Comments
 (0)